The perfect escape  Cover Image Book Book

The perfect escape / Suzanne Park.

Park, Suzanne, (author.).

Summary:

Told in two voices, Nate Jae-Woo Kim and Kate Anderson team up in a survivalist competition hoping the prize money will help his proud Korean family and enable her to pursue her dream of becoming an actress.
When one of his classmates offers Nate Jae-Woo Kim a ridiculous amount of money to commit grade fraud, he knows that taking the windfall would help support his prideful Korean family. But is compromising his integrity worth it? Kate Anderson, Nate's colleague at the zombie-themed escape room where they work, has an alternate plan. A local tech company is hosting a weekend-long survivalist competition with a huge cash prize. If the two team up-- and win-- It could solve all of Nate's problems, and Kate wants the money to escape her controlling father. But the real challenge? Making it through the weekend with their hearts intact. -- adapted from back cover
